黑狐家游戏

大数据计算能力不足?别担心!这些方法帮你提升,大数据不足之处

欧气 1 0

在当今这个信息爆炸的时代,大数据已经成为了推动各行各业发展的核心力量,许多企业和个人在实际操作中却常常遇到“大数据计算有欠缺”这一问题,如何才能有效提升大数据处理能力呢?

理解大数据计算的需求与挑战

大数据计算的需求分析

大数据计算的核心在于对海量数据的快速处理和分析,这要求我们具备强大的数据处理能力和高效的算法设计能力,我们需要关注以下几个方面:

  • 数据来源:了解数据的来源和类型,以便选择合适的处理工具和方法;
  • 数据规模:评估数据的规模,以确定所需的硬件资源和软件性能;
  • 处理速度:确保系统能够实时或接近实时地处理大量数据。

大数据计算的挑战识别

在大数据处理的实际过程中,可能会面临以下几种挑战:

  • 技术瓶颈:如内存限制、I/O瓶颈等;
  • 算法优化:如何提高算法效率以适应大规模数据处理;
  • 安全性考虑:保护隐私和数据安全的重要性不容忽视;
  • 可扩展性:随着数据量的增加,系统需要具备良好的可扩展性。

提升大数据计算能力的策略与方法

选择合适的技术栈

为了应对上述挑战,我们可以采取一些有效的措施来提升大数据处理能力:

大数据计算能力不足?别担心!这些方法帮你提升,大数据不足之处

图片来源于网络,如有侵权联系删除

(1)分布式存储与计算框架的选择

目前市面上有许多优秀的开源项目可供选择,例如Hadoop生态圈中的HDFS(Hadoop Distributed File System)、Spark Streaming等,它们提供了丰富的功能支持,能够帮助我们构建高性能的大数据处理平台。

(2)并行化技术的应用

通过引入多线程或多进程等技术手段,可以将任务分解为多个子任务并行执行,从而显著提高整体的处理速度,还可以利用GPU加速技术进一步加快计算过程。

(3)缓存机制的使用

对于频繁访问的数据项,可以使用缓存技术将其保存在内存中以减少磁盘I/O操作的时间开销,常用的缓存解决方案包括Redis、Memcached等。

数据预处理与清洗

高质量的数据是进行准确分析和决策的基础,在进行大规模数据处理之前,需要对原始数据进行必要的预处理和清洗工作,这包括但不限于:

  • 去重去噪:去除重复记录和不相关噪声;
  • 格式标准化:将不同格式的数据转换为统一的格式便于后续处理;
  • 缺失值填充:填补缺失的数据点以保证完整性。

模型设计与优化

在设计机器学习模型时,需要注意以下几点:

  • 样本平衡:确保正负样本的比例合理,避免偏差过大影响模型的准确性;
  • 参数调优:通过调整超参数来寻找最佳的性能表现;
  • 转换器使用:借助特征工程技巧生成更有价值的特征向量。

实时流数据处理

对于时效性较强的业务场景,如金融交易监控、物流追踪等,实时流数据处理显得尤为重要,这时可以考虑采用Apache Kafka这样的消息队列系统作为中间件,实现数据的实时传输和处理。

大数据计算能力不足?别担心!这些方法帮你提升,大数据不足之处

图片来源于网络,如有侵权联系删除

案例分析与实践经验分享

案例一:某电商公司的大数据分析实践

该企业在日常运营中积累了海量的用户行为数据和商品销售数据,为了更好地洞察市场趋势并为用户提供个性化的推荐服务,他们决定搭建一套完整的大数据处理体系,经过多方考察后选择了Hadoop生态系统作为底层架构,并结合了Spark Streaming进行实时流数据处理,还引入了ELK Stack(Elasticsearch、Logstash、Kibana)用于日志管理和可视化展示,最终实现了对海量数据的实时分析和挖掘,取得了显著的商业价值。

经验总结

在实际项目中,除了技术和工具的选择外,团队协作和文化建设同样至关重要,只有全员参与、共同进步的氛围才能推动项目的顺利实施和发展壮大。

未来发展趋势展望

随着科技的不断进步和创新,未来的大数据计算领域将会迎来更多新的机遇和挑战,预计以下几个方面将成为重点关注方向:

  • 深度学习和强化学习的深入研究与应用;
  • 区块链技术在数据安全和隐私保护方面的探索;
  • 新兴边缘计算技术的融合与发展。

“大数据计算有欠缺”并非不可克服的难题,只要我们紧跟时代步伐,勇于尝试新技术和新方法,就一定能够在激烈的市场竞争中脱颖而出,赢得先机。

标签: #大数据计算有欠缺

黑狐家游戏
  • 评论列表

留言评论